5 of 5 stars overall, with a 5-star health inspection rating and 0 fines in the last 24 months. Staffing is a concern at 2 of 5 stars, with reported nurse staffing at 3.24 hours per resident per day versus the 4.1 federal benchmark.
Last inspection: February 25, 2026Penalties, last 24 months: $0
Federal guidance recommends at least 4.1 nursing hours per resident each day. This facility reports 3.2381.

What the inspectors found
The home failed to make sure food was safely sourced, stored, prepared, and served according to professional standards. Cited February 2024 — widespread issue, immediate jeopardy to residents.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 812 — 42 CFR §483.60(i) — S/S: L
The nursing home failed to provide and carry out an infection prevention and control program to help keep residents from getting or spreading infections. Cited February 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 880 — 42 CFR §483.80(a) — S/S: E
The nursing home failed to keep the area free of hazards and provide enough supervision to prevent accidents. Cited February 2024 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 689 — 42 CFR §483.25(d) — S/S: E
The nursing home failed to protect residents from abuse and neglect by others. Cited November 2023 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 600 — 42 CFR §483.12 — S/S: E
The home failed to promptly report suspected abuse, neglect, or theft and share the investigation results with the proper authorities. Cited February 2026 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 609 — 42 CFR §483.12 — S/S: D
